How to Implement the NIST Cybersecurity Framework at a Mid-Market Company

Sam Wheeler · August 3, 2026

The NIST Cybersecurity Framework has become the de facto standard for how organizations structure their security programs. Most mid-market security and IT leaders have heard of it. Far fewer have actually used it as an operational tool rather than a compliance checkbox.

The framework's value isn't in having it on a shelf. It's in using it to understand where you are, decide where you need to be, and build a credible path between those two points. Here's how to do that.

Step 1: Build Your Current State Profile

The CSF organizes security capabilities into five functions — Identify, Protect, Detect, Respond, Recover — each broken into categories and subcategories. A current state profile is your honest assessment of how well your organization performs against each of those subcategories today.

This isn't a pass/fail exercise. The goal is accuracy. For each subcategory, you're asking: do we have this capability? Is it documented? Is it operating consistently? Is it measured?

For a mid-market company, a credible current state profile requires input from more than just IT. HR owns the acceptable use policy and security awareness training. Legal owns the incident notification process. Finance owns the recovery time objectives. The assessment needs those perspectives to be accurate.

A complete current state profile typically takes two to four weeks when done properly. Rushing it produces a document that looks complete but doesn't reflect reality — which makes everything that follows less useful.

Step 2: Define a Target State Profile

The target state answers: given our risk profile, regulatory environment, and business objectives, where do our capabilities need to be?

This is a business conversation as much as a technical one. A healthcare company handling PHI under HIPAA has different target state requirements than a SaaS company pursuing SOC 2. A company with significant operational technology has different Recover requirements than a cloud-native business.

The CSF implementation tiers — from Partial (Tier 1) to Adaptive (Tier 4) — provide a useful reference for defining how mature each function needs to be. Most mid-market companies should target Tier 2 (Risk Informed) broadly, with Tier 3 (Repeatable) for their highest-risk functions. Targeting Tier 4 across the board is usually neither realistic nor necessary.

Step 3: Conduct the Gap Analysis

With current and target states defined, the gap analysis is straightforward: where does your current state fall short of your target, and by how much?

This is where the work becomes actionable. A gap in the Protect/Identity Management category means something specific — you need better access controls, MFA enforcement, or privileged access management. A gap in Detect/Security Continuous Monitoring means you need to build or improve your logging and alerting capability.

Document each gap with enough specificity to plan remediation. "Improve detection capabilities" is not actionable. "Deploy SIEM with 90-day log retention and defined alert rules for the top 10 attack patterns in our environment" is.

Step 4: Prioritize and Build Your Roadmap

Not all gaps are equal, and you can't close them all at once. Prioritization should combine two factors: how significant is the risk exposure created by this gap, and how much effort does it take to close?

High-impact, lower-effort gaps close first — these are your quick wins. High-impact, high-effort gaps require phased planning. Low-impact gaps can wait.

Most mid-market organizations end up with a 12–18 month roadmap organized into quarterly milestones. That's the right scope — long enough to address substantive gaps, short enough to maintain organizational momentum and adjust as priorities shift.

The roadmap becomes your security program plan. It's how you communicate priorities to leadership, justify budget requests, and demonstrate progress over time. A CSF-aligned roadmap is increasingly recognized by auditors, insurers, and enterprise customers as evidence of security program maturity.

Step 5: Track Progress and Repeat the Assessment

The CSF implementation is not a one-time project. The most effective organizations treat it as an annual cycle: reassess current state, update the target profile as business objectives evolve, close gaps from the prior year, and identify new ones.

This gives you something more valuable than a static compliance document: trend data. Year-over-year improvement in your CSF profile is a concrete, communicable measure of security program progress — useful for board reporting, customer assurance, and cyber insurance applications.

Where Most Mid-Market Companies Get Stuck

The most common failure mode isn't ignorance of the framework. It's the gap between assessment and action. Organizations conduct a CSF assessment, identify the gaps, and then struggle to translate findings into a funded, owned, prioritized program.

Two things help: executive sponsorship of specific remediation workstreams — not just the security program in the abstract — and someone accountable for tracking progress against the roadmap on a cadence that actually enforces it.
